6) The formula to calculate payback period is:-
1) When cash flows are even = Initial investment / Cash flow per period
2) When cash flows are uneven = We need to calculate the cumulative net cash flow for each period and then use the following formula for payback period = A + [B/C]
A is the last period with a negative cumulative cash flow;
B is the absolute value of cumulative cash flow at the end of the period A;
C is the total cash flow during the period after A
